**Clerk of Works**:
**Salary**: £37,422 - £41,335 per year
**Location**: Selkirk Office, with travel across the Scottish Borders
**Hours**: Full-time, Monday to Friday, 35 hours per week
**Contract**: Permanent
**Closing Date**: Friday 16 January 2026
Are you a construction professional who takes pride in quality, collaboration and making a difference to people’s lives? Join Scottish Borders Housing Association as our Clerk of Works and play a key role in delivering our £77 million development programme, creating 300 new homes across the Scottish Borders by 2028.
**What you'll do**:
- Carry out regular site inspections, ensuring all works meet SBHA's high standard and regulatory requirements.
- Build strong relationships with contractors and colleagues, fostering a collaborative approach to problem-solving.
- Oversee health and safety compliance, reporting and resolving issues swiftly.
- Coordinate handovers, ensuring homes are defect-free and ready for tenants.
- Represent SBHA at meetings, with residents and during inspections.
**What you'll bring**:
- HND/C or equivalent in Building (or substantial relevant experience).
- Significant construction and property experience.
- A keen eye for quality and detail, with a commitment to excellence.
- Experience in inspecting workmanship.
- Strong communication and IT skills.
- Knowledge of affordable housing delivery
- A collaborative, proactive approach and a full UK driving licence.
